> One note: I initialized the controls in sd_init. That's wrong, it should be
> sd_config. sd_init is also called on resume, so that would initialize the
> controls twice.

You cannot move the initializing of the controls to sd_config, since in many
cases the sensor probing is done in sd_init, and we need to know the sensor
type to init the controls. I suggest that instead you give the sd_init
function a resume parameter and only init the controls if the resume parameter
is false.
